台湾的软玉 被引量:15

The Nephrite of Taiwan

摘要 台湾软玉形成于五万年前,系超镁铁岩变成的蛇纹岩经交代而成。软玉主要为普通软玉、猫眼玉和蜡光玉三种。比其它的软玉稍硬些,且硬度与闪光性都有方向性,并含数种矿物包裹体。其地球化学特征是含铬极高,并影响到软玉的颜色。 The carbon-14 dating indicates that formation of Taiwan nephrite could be as early as fifty thousand years ago. The nephrite occurrences are known over an north-south distance of 60km, but production has been mainly from Fentien nephrite belt which is approximately 10 km long by 3 km wide extending from the Chiakangchi in the south to the Paipoaochi in the north. The Taiwan nephrite can be classified as common,cat' a-eye,and waxy nephrites,with 100 Mg/(Mg+Fe+Mn) atomic ratios:85. 5—92. 2,density: 1. 96—3. 04,a:0. 975—0. 997nm,b:l. 794—1. 811nm,c:0. 511—0. 532nm,α—1. 602—1. 610,β:1.622—1. 628,γ:1.625—1. 635. The hardness rangs from 472 to 1 000±kg/mm^2 in Vickers hardness,equivalent to 5 — 7 of Mohs scale,the latter value being higer than any value ever reported for nephrite and tremolite. The tremolite fibers are arranged in some crystallographic orientations, with the c(001) face perpendlicular to the fibrous structure. Cat' s-eye phenomenon can be observed on a(100) and b(010),but cannot on c(001). Absorption is stronger on c than on other faces. Chromite, picotite, grossular, serpentine, and chalcopyrite are the common inclusions in the nephrite. Because the nephrite occurs in the hanging walls and footwalls of serpentinite,and because the nephrite contains serpentine and chromite inclusions and has similar amounts of trace elements as the serpentinite,the Taiwan nephrite deposit is believed to be a metasomatic product of serpentinite derived from ultramafic rock. In addition,the bowenite,a yellowish green translucent serpentine,was minde in Taiwan and sold as nephrite. Spectrographic analyses of 53 Taiwan nephrites show in average (μg/g),Co 36, Cr 1044, Cu 17, Mn 1346, Ni 647, V 10, and Ti 24. Eight serpentinite samples,which are associated with nephrite, contain similar anounts of these trace elements. White and green nephrites contain approximately the same amount of FeO. Cr and Ni are responsible for the emerald-green color of tremolite nephrite. Agreen-yellow index:T(510+520+530+540nm)/T(590+600+610+620nm) is proposed by L. P. Tan to judge the degree of the coloration of nephrite. The transmittance is high in cat' s-eye nephrite,medium in common nephrite,and low in waxy nephrite which is nearly subtanslucent to cryptocrystalline texture. The minerals associated with the nephrite in Taiwan were studied by five methods. Olivine,antigorite, chrysotile, pycnochlorite, actinolite-tremolite, talc, brucite, diopside, magnesite, dolomite. calcite, aragonite,quartz,titanite,chromite,picotite,magnetite,pyrrhotite,pyrite and chalcopyrite were found in the serpentinite. Diopside, zoisite, clinozoisite, epidote, actinolite-tremolite, grossular, hydrogrossular, quartz, clinochlore, calcite, vesuvianite, chromite, picotite and ilmenite were found in the diopsidefels. Clinogoisite, quartz, actinolite, tremolite, muscovite, albite, calcite, diopside,graphite and sanidine were found in the metasediments.
